Narendar-Bommera/Enterprise_Security_System
GitHub: Narendar-Bommera/Enterprise_Security_System
基于 Flask 和 Nmap 的企业级 Web 漏洞扫描器,提供自动化端口检测、服务识别及专业报告生成功能。
Stars: 0 | Forks: 0
# 企业 Security System
Enterprise Vulnerability Scanner 是一个基于 Web 的网络安全工具,旨在识别目标主机或网络中潜在的安全弱点。该应用程序执行自动化扫描以检测开放端口、运行服务和相关漏洞,然后生成结构化报告用于安全分析和修复。
GitHub 主页文档。
包含:
项目描述
功能特性
安装说明
使用方法
截图
作者
示例标题:
# 企业 Vulnerability Scanner
一个基于 Web 的网络安全工具,用于扫描网络主机,
识别漏洞,并生成专业报告。
Enterprise-Vulnerability-Scanner
│
├── app.py
├── scanner.py
├── report_generator.py
├── requirements.txt
├── README.md
│
├── static
│ │
│ ├── css
│ │ └── style.css
│ │
│ ├── js
│ │ └── script.js
│ │
│ └── reports
│ ├── pdf
│ └── excel
│
├── templates
│ │
│ └── index.html
│
├── scans
│ └── scan_results.json
│
└── docs
└── project_report.pdf
📄 文件说明
------app.py
主 Flask 应用程序。
处理:
API 路由
扫描请求
下载报告
前端通信
-----scanner.py
核心网络扫描逻辑。
处理:
Nmap 执行
服务检测
漏洞映射
CVE 查询
------report_generator.py
生成专业报告。
功能:
PDF 报告
Excel 报告
CVE 表格
所有者详情
扫描摘要
--------requirements.txt
项目依赖。
flask
python-nmap
pandas
openpyxl
reportlab
安装方式:
pip install -r requirements.txt
--------------🌐 前端
templates/index.html
主仪表板 UI。
包含:
目标 IP 输入
所有者详情
扫描按钮
终端输出
严重漏洞警报
下载按钮
---------static/css/style.css
包含以下样式:
暗色 UI
终端
按钮
警报
仪表板布局
标签:Claude, CTI, CVE检测, Flask, Nmap, Python, URL短链接分析, 企业安全, 加密, 反取证, 安全评估, 密码管理, 开源安全工具, 插件系统, 数据统计, 无后门, 服务探测, 漏洞扫描器, 端口扫描, 网络安全, 网络安全审计, 网络资产管理, 虚拟驱动器, 逆向工具, 逆向工程平台, 隐私保护, 风险分析